Working Principle of the Pludo Spin & Weave Science Kit

  • Clothing fabrics are created by interlacing two sets of threads called warp and weft.
  • A traditional loom consists of four main parts: the frame, shuttle, heddle, and reed.
  • The shedding mechanism raises and lowers warp threads to create an opening called a shed.
  • The shuttle carries the weft thread through the shed from one side to the other.
  • The reed pushes the weft thread into place, making the fabric tighter and more uniform.
  • In this loom model, a cross-roller mechanism rotates 90° to alternate the position of the warp threads.
  • Repeating the processes of shedding, weft insertion, and beating creates a woven fabric.
  • The model demonstrates three key weaving motions: opening the shed (up and down), moving the shuttle (side to side), and beating the weft into place (back and forth).
